‘Warp Composers’ represents artists across the Warp Publishing and Warp Records rosters from their offices in London & Los Angeles.
For over 15 years, their list of artists have provided unique original scores for award-winning films and series from directors such as the Safdie Brothers, Sofia Coppola, Johann Renck, Peter Strickland, the Duffer Brothers, Bo Burnham and Yorgos Lanthimos.
They have worked with A24, HBO, Netflix, BBC, Channel 4, Sky, Canal + and Warp Films, our composers have consistently created iconic soundtracks such as Uncut Gems, Eighth Grade, Stranger Things, Berberian Sound Studio and many more.
The warp composers website design was developed by CTP – Conversation Taking Place, an independent design studio based in Berlin. The site serves as a digital platform and collective archive for Warp Composers—a group of musicians and sound designers working across disciplines.
The website is informed by the group’s shared language: generative sound, layered rhythm, and non-linear composition. Our creative direction took inspiration from tempo, fragmentation, and silence—designing a structure that mirrors how the collective thinks and works.
Navigation unfolds gradually, using modular sections that reflect layered sound. Transitions are subtle and rhythmically paced. Rather than a top-down system, the site flows horizontally—looping between content types and creating intuitive pathways.
Typography remains neutral, letting the sonic material and visuals take precedence. Layouts were designed to be fluid, allowing both individual works and collective presence to coexist.
The warp composers website design supports audio, video, and text in equal measure. It adapts to different types of contributions—performances, installations, essays, and sound archives.
The site was built in collaboration with the group, shaping a platform that reflects their shared ethos. Design elements were guided by musical logic: repetition, pause, and transformation.
Color, spacing, and motion respond subtly to user interaction—creating an experience that feels alive without being overwhelming.
